Diploma of Quality Auditing CRICOS 111291E

Diploma of Quality Auditing (CRICOS 111291E) at Helix College Pty Ltd

Diploma of Quality Auditing (CRICOS course code 111291E) is a Diploma (AQF Level 5) delivered by Helix College Pty Ltd over 1 year (52 weeks). This course is registered on the Commonwealth Register of Institutions and Courses for Overseas Students (CRICOS), ensuring it meets Australian standards for international education. Helix College Pty Ltd (CRICOS 03935F) is a private provider offering this program in Melbourne, Victoria. The course falls under the field of Management and Commerce, specifically Business and Management. As an international student, you can apply for a Student visa (Subclass 500) to study this diploma. What you'll study

This diploma covers principles and practices of quality auditing within a business context. Students typically learn to plan, conduct, and report audits, evaluate compliance with standards, and recommend improvements. The curriculum aligns with the BSB50920 national training package. Graduates often pursue roles as quality auditors, compliance officers, or quality assurance managers. While the exact syllabus is set by Helix College, the course focuses on developing skills in risk management, continuous improvement, and regulatory frameworks. As a Diploma-level qualification, it also builds analytical and communication skills essential for leadership roles.

Duration and study mode

According to CRICOS, the Diploma of Quality Auditing has a duration of 1 year (52 weeks). The language of instruction is English. This is a single qualification (no dual or foundation studies). Helix College delivers this course on campus at two Melbourne locations: Level 1 & 2 Little Collins Street and Level 3 - 608E St Kilda Road. Students should expect a full-time study load, typically 20-25 contact hours per week. There is no mandatory work component included in the course.

Fees (indicative — set by Helix College Pty Ltd)

The indicative tuition fee for the Diploma of Quality Auditing is A$24,000, with non-tuition fees of A$2,500, making an estimated total of A$26,500. These fees are sourced from the CRICOS register and are subject to change. Additional costs not included are Overseas Student Health Cover (OSHC), living expenses (approximately A$21,041 per year as per Department of Home Affairs), and the visa application charge (currently A$1,600). Student visa

To study this diploma, you need a Student visa (Subclass 500). This visa allows you to study full-time, work part-time (48 hours per fortnight during term, unlimited during breaks), and stay in Australia for the duration of your course. You must meet the GTE requirement, maintain OSHC, and demonstrate financial capacity. After completing your diploma, you may be eligible for a Temporary Graduate visa (Subclass 485) depending on your qualifications and career goals.
